Fix some EGLDisplay * abuse
authorAdam Jackson <ajax@redhat.com>
Mon, 10 Oct 2016 18:10:38 +0000 (14:10 -0400)
committerMatthias Clasen <mclasen@redhat.com>
Mon, 10 Oct 2016 18:17:09 +0000 (14:17 -0400)
EGLDisplays are already opaque pointers, and eglGetDisplay returns an
EGLDisplay not a pointer to one.

Signed-off-by: Adam Jackson <ajax@redhat.com>
https://bugzilla.gnome.org/show_bug.cgi?id=772415

gdk/wayland/gdkglcontext-wayland.c
gtk/inspector/general.c

index 7733188ac2d2e6504db88945dbf3e4ccfec27df6..ae1354ef70fef884eb28f2cc60414be53ec3d240 100644 (file)
@@ -279,7 +279,7 @@ gdk_wayland_display_init_gl (GdkDisplay *display)
 {
   GdkWaylandDisplay *display_wayland = GDK_WAYLAND_DISPLAY (display);
   EGLint major, minor;
-  EGLDisplay *dpy;
+  EGLDisplay dpy;
 
   if (display_wayland->have_egl)
     return TRUE;
index 31dd6aac9e26720a4ddcf653b2499300521a2f46..77d0a767f10d57b8493a1e52da73c99c8ae9c3db 100644 (file)
@@ -209,7 +209,7 @@ append_glx_extension_row (GtkInspectorGeneral *gen,
 #ifdef GDK_WINDOWING_WAYLAND
 static void
 append_egl_extension_row (GtkInspectorGeneral *gen,
-                          EGLDisplay          *dpy,
+                          EGLDisplay          dpy,
                           const gchar         *ext)
 {
   add_check_row (gen, GTK_LIST_BOX (gen->priv->gl_box), ext, epoxy_has_egl_extension (dpy, ext), 0);
@@ -250,7 +250,7 @@ init_gl (GtkInspectorGeneral *gen)
   if (GDK_IS_WAYLAND_DISPLAY (gdk_display_get_default ()))
     {
       GdkDisplay *display = gdk_display_get_default ();
-      EGLDisplay *dpy;
+      EGLDisplay dpy;
       EGLint major, minor;
       gchar *version;